Bill 30 could make condo living easier in Alberta

Condo Control

Alberta has tabled legislation that aims to improve governance in condominium communities. Bill 30 , the Service Alberta Statutes Amendment Act, 2024, would impact three different Acts: Condominium Property Act Prompt Payment and Construction Lien Act (PPCLA) Public Works Act (PWA) Developers and contractors would also benefit from this Act.

How a condo/HOA attorney might navigate new Florida laws

Condo Control

Websites and records All HOAs that contain 100 parcels or more must maintain a website or application that can be downloaded through a phone, states HB 1203. Similarly, HB 1237 requires condo associations with 150 or more units (excluding timeshare units) to have a website or application that complies with specific obligations.

Reserve study requirements by state

Condo Control

Many states have or are considering enforcing laws that regulate reserves. Motivated by the Surfside condo collapse, lawmakers don’t ever want to see another community in the same position as the Miami condominium ended up in. Reserve funds and studies have become a hot topic among condo and HOA communities.
